Major Revisions to UAE Tax Procedures Announced for 2026

The Ministry of Finance has revealed crucial modifications to the tax procedures law in the UAE, unveiling clearer guidelines for tax obligations and refund periods. These updates, detailed in Federal Decree-Law No. (17) of 2025, will come into force on January 1, 2026.

Under this new framework, taxpayers are allocated a maximum of five years post the tax period to request refunds of credit balances held with the Federal Tax Authority (FTA), or to apply these balances to outstanding tax dues. This structured timeframe aims to enhance certainty and instill better financial discipline within tax processes.

The revisions also provide essential flexibility for situations in which a credit balance emerges after the five-year span or within the last ninety days of that timeline, allowing eligible taxpayers to make refund requests without losing their rights due to timing issues.

Another significant change involves extending the limitation periods. The FTA is now permitted to perform tax audits or issue assessments even after the standard limitation period has concluded, in certain specified situations—such as when a refund request is made within the last year of that period. This measure aims to balance the protection of taxpayer rights with the state’s financial interests.

Additionally, the Authority is empowered to issue binding guidance on the interpretation of tax legislation. Such directions will assist both taxpayers and the Authority itself, fostering consistent interpretation and practical enforcement across a variety of tax situations.

Transitional provisions are also included for taxpayers facing expired or impending credit balance timelines. Those whose five-year period lapsed before January 1, 2026—or will lapse in the year following it—are granted a one-year window from January 1, 2026, to submit refund requests. They may also file voluntary disclosures within two years if no decision regarding these requests has yet been made.

Through these amendments, the UAE seeks to enhance transparency, streamline tax operations, and foster a more efficient business environment, aligning with the country’s broader goal of modernizing its financial systems and ensuring sustainable economic resilience.
